Chocolate Coconut Cake Recipe

Chocolate Coconut Cake Recipe

The layers of chocolate and coconuts make it seem sophisticated, yet it's so easy to prepare!
5 from 1 vote
Rate
Preparation Time: 1 hour hr 10 minutes mins
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: Mediterranean

Equipment

Medium-sized baking pan or 10” round baking pan (26 cm)

Ingredients

  • 4 eggs (unseparated)
  • 1 cup sugar
  • ½ cup oil
  • 7 oz. cultured buttermilk (200 ml or ¾ cup orange juice)
  • 2 cups flour
  • 1 cup shredded coconut
  • 2¼ tsp. baking powder (10 g)
  • 1 tsp. vanilla extract
  • 3½ oz. chopped chocolate (100 g)

Instructions

  • Heat up the oven to 330°F (165°C) with convection.
  • Oil and dust (with flour) a medium-sized baking pan or a 10” (26 cm) round baking pan.
  • Sift the flour together with the baking powder into a bowl.
  • Add the shredded coconut and chopped chocolate, and mix well.
  • In a separate bowl, beat the eggs together with the sugar until the batter is light and fluffy.
  • While beating, add the oil.
  • Add the cultured buttermilk and flour mixture to the egg batter.
  • Mix until smooth.
  • Transfer the batter to the baking pan and bake for 25 to 30 minutes.
  • After cooling down, powder with confectioner’s sugar or coat with chocolate frosting.
